Skywalking安装与MySQL数据库连接

在当今的数字化时代,应用程序的性能监控和日志管理变得尤为重要。Skywalking作为一款优秀的APM(Application Performance Management)工具,能够帮助开发者实时监控应用程序的性能,及时发现并解决问题。而MySQL作为一款流行的开源关系型数据库,是许多企业应用的核心组件。本文将详细介绍Skywalking的安装过程以及如何将其与MySQL数据库进行连接,帮助您轻松实现应用程序的性能监控。 Skywalking 安装 Skywalking的安装非常简单,以下是详细的步骤: 1. 下载安装包:首先,您需要从Skywalking的官方网站下载最新的安装包。目前,Skywalking支持多种安装方式,包括Docker、RPM、DEB等。 2. 启动Skywalking:以RPM为例,您可以使用以下命令启动Skywalking: ```bash sudo systemctl start skywalking ``` 3. 访问Skywalking界面:启动Skywalking后,您可以在浏览器中访问`http://localhost:8080`,默认用户名为`admin`,密码为`skywalking`。 Skywalking 与 MySQL 数据库连接 在Skywalking中,您可以将应用程序的性能数据存储到多种数据库中,包括MySQL、Oracle、PostgreSQL等。以下是如何将Skywalking与MySQL数据库进行连接的步骤: 1. 配置数据库连接:在Skywalking界面,点击左侧菜单栏的“配置”选项,然后选择“存储配置”。 2. 添加MySQL存储:在“存储配置”页面,点击“添加存储”按钮,选择“MySQL”。 3. 填写MySQL连接信息:在弹出的窗口中,填写以下信息: - 存储类型:选择“MySQL”。 - 数据库名:填写您的数据库名。 - 用户名:填写数据库用户名。 - 密码:填写数据库密码。 - 主机:填写数据库主机地址。 - 端口:填写数据库端口号。 4. 保存配置:填写完信息后,点击“保存”按钮。 案例分析 假设您正在开发一个使用Spring Boot框架的应用程序,并且希望使用Skywalking对其进行性能监控。以下是如何在Spring Boot项目中集成Skywalking的步骤: 1. 添加依赖:在项目的`pom.xml`文件中添加以下依赖: ```xml org.skywalking skywalking-spring-boot-starter 8.0.0 ``` 2. 配置Skywalking:在项目的`application.properties`文件中添加以下配置: ```properties skywalking.agent.application-name=your-application-name skywalking.agent.collector frontend=127.0.0.1:11800 ``` 3. 启动应用程序:启动应用程序后,Skywalking将自动开始收集性能数据。 通过以上步骤,您就可以将Skywalking与MySQL数据库进行连接,并实现应用程序的性能监控。希望本文对您有所帮助!

猜你喜欢:可观测性平台